| MSD and Ingenuity Systems renew licensing agreement | Posted on 15/02/2007 in Pharmaceutical Company Product News Ingenuity Systems announced it has signed a renewal agreement with MSD regarding the licensing of its biological modelling software application.
As part of the agreement, pharmaceutical company MSD will continue to use the Ingenuity Pathways Analysis (IPA) software system, which enables researchers to analyse and interpret complex biological models.
California-based Ingenuity Systems confirmed that the multi-year deal assures that scientists at MSD will continue to make use of the IPA application for future years in the course of their biological exploration and life sciences research.
"The expansion of our licensing agreement demonstrates [MSD's] commitment to solutions that help researchers rapidly derive biological meaning from their complex data," commented Peter DiLaura, spokesman for Ingenuity Systems.
In addition to the IPA software, the company has a knowledge database which contains details on biological interactions produced by millions of modelled relationships between drugs, cells, diseases and other matter. Ingenuity has claimed the database is the largest of its kind in the world with the greatest accuracy and most descriptive system. Last month, the company confirmed it had signed a renewal and expansion licensing agreement for its IPA software with the Genomics Institute of the Novartis Research Foundation.
